Stable 22.2V Output for 6S Drone Systems

The battery uses a 6S configuration with six cell groups connected in series. It provides a nominal voltage of 22.2V and is compatible with many propulsion systems designed for 6S power.

Stable voltage output helps the motors, electronic speed controllers, flight controller, communication equipment, and onboard payload operate consistently throughout the flight. This is particularly important for long-range missions, where unexpected voltage drops may affect flight stability, transmission distance, or the safe return of the aircraft.

Before selecting the pack, users should confirm the supported voltage range of the motor, ESC, charger, and other electronic components. A properly matched system improves energy utilization and reduces unnecessary stress on both the battery and the aircraft.

15000mAh Capacity for Extended Flight Time

The 15000mAh capacity gives the aircraft more available energy than standard low-capacity FPV packs. It can support longer flight durations when paired with an efficient propulsion system and a correctly balanced airframe.

Actual flight time depends on several factors, including:

  • Total takeoff weight
  • Motor and propeller efficiency
  • Average operating current
  • Flight speed and maneuvering style
  • Wind and outdoor temperature
  • Payload weight
  • Battery discharge cutoff settings

A larger capacity does not automatically guarantee the best flight performance. The additional energy must be evaluated together with the pack’s weight and dimensions. For this reason, battery customization is often required for professional drone projects. The pack should fit the available battery compartment while maintaining the aircraft’s correct center of gravity.

Advantages of 21700 Lithium-Ion Cells

21700 cylindrical cells are widely selected for high-capacity battery packs because they can offer strong energy density, reliable structural stability, and good cycle performance. Compared with some smaller cylindrical formats, fewer cells may be required to reach the desired capacity, helping simplify the internal pack structure.

For long-endurance FPV aircraft, energy density is a key consideration. A suitable 21700 cell can store substantial energy without making the battery excessively large. This supports longer missions while maintaining a practical balance between capacity, weight, size, and output capability.

Cell consistency is equally important. Cells used in the same pack should be carefully matched according to capacity, voltage, and internal resistance. Consistent cells discharge more evenly, improve pack stability, and reduce the risk of individual groups reaching their voltage limits too early.

10C Discharge Capability for Reliable Power Delivery

A 10C discharge rating provides the current output required by many large FPV drones and RC aircraft. With a rated capacity of 15000mAh, the pack is designed to support substantial continuous power when used within the specified operating conditions.

The battery can provide stable energy during takeoff, climbing, cruising, and moderate acceleration. However, system designers should not select a battery only by looking at the advertised C-rate. The aircraft’s continuous current, peak current, flight duration, cooling conditions, and connector rating must also be considered.

Using appropriate cable sizes and low-resistance connectors helps reduce heat generation and voltage loss. The ESC and motor combination should also be tested under realistic load conditions before the aircraft enters regular operation.

Charging, Storage, and Daily Maintenance

A charger designed for 6S lithium-ion batteries should be used. Balance charging is recommended because it allows the charger to monitor and manage the voltage of each series group.

The battery should not be charged unattended or near flammable materials. After flight, users should allow the pack to cool before charging it again. Batteries should also be inspected regularly for swelling, damaged insulation, loose cables, deformed connectors, or unusual heating.

For storage, the pack should be kept in a dry, ventilated area away from direct sunlight, moisture, and extreme temperatures. Long-term storage at a full or deeply discharged state may accelerate performance degradation. Following the recommended storage voltage can help preserve capacity and service life.
